Scope of Treatment



Emergency situation dental care concentrates on dealing with urgent oral problems such as extreme toothaches or injuries that require prompt attention. When you experience sudden and intense pain, swelling, bleeding, or injury to your teeth or gums, looking for instant treatment from an emergency situation dental expert is vital. These specialized oral professionals are geared up to manage severe situations that can not wait for a routine appointment.

Whether it's a knocked-out tooth, a fractured tooth, or excruciating pain, emergency dental care supplies timely relief and essential treatment to alleviate your discomfort.

In emergency dental care, the primary objective is to stabilize your condition, handle your pain, and prevent further damages to your oral health and wellness. From carrying out emergency situation removals to providing short-lived dental fillings or repairs, the emphasis gets on attending to the prompt problem available. Once the urgent issue is dealt with, you might be referred back to your routine dental expert for any kind of follow-up care or additional therapy required to recover your dental health and wellness.

Price and Insurance coverage



Considering the financial facet of oral care, understanding the distinctions in price and insurance protection between emergency dentistry and regular dentistry is necessary. Emergency situation dental care frequently includes a higher price compared to routine oral solutions. Since emergencies generally need immediate interest, the prices might consist of after-hours fees or expedited solutions, which can include in the overall expense.

On the other hand, routine dental care normally includes planned check outs for precautionary treatment, routine examinations, and common procedures like cleanings and fillings, which are normally much more affordable.

When it comes to insurance coverage, emergency situation dental services might often have limited alternatives approved by service providers, bring about potential out-of-pocket costs for people. On the other hand, normal dental care is normally extra lined up with typical insurance plans, making it simpler for people to use their insurance coverage and reduce personal costs.

Before looking for oral treatment, it's advisable to talk to both your dental practitioner and insurance policy company to recognize the coverage offered for emergency situation versus normal oral solutions.
